Ventilation Setup: Everything You Need to Know

A good ventilation system is critically important for ensuring optimal air flow in any indoor garden . Getting it right your ventilation can greatly impact overall success. Here’s what you have to know. First, you’ll need exhaust fans sized correctly for your room – generally, target between one to a times the room’s volume each hour. Consider carbon filters to remove odors before fumes are released the space . Finally, remember intake vents – you need to provide fumes to refresh what's vented.

  • Size the correct ventilation fan .
  • Include carbon filtration .
  • Set up air inlets.
